Brief Explanations:

The Fourteenth Amendment granted equal protection under the law and citizenship rights to former slaves. Over time, it has been used as a legal basis for many equal - rights cases in American history. It has had a significant impact on American society, contrary to the first option. It was not related to making it difficult for African Americans to vote (that was more related to other Jim - Crow era laws), and the Black Codes pre - dated the Fourteenth Amendment and the amendment was meant to counteract some of their effects.

Answer:

The Fourteenth Amendment later became the basis for equal rights claims.
